Asset Protection Benefits
The primary reason investors seek an NJ LLC real estate loan is the robust asset protection an LLC structure provides. When you hold property in an LLC, your personal assets remain separate from your real estate investments. This legal separation means that if someone files a lawsuit against your rental property, they cannot pursue your personal home, savings accounts, or other assets. For Jersey City investors dealing with high-value properties and substantial rental income, this protection becomes invaluable.
Many LLC mortgage lenders in NJ recognize this benefit and have developed specialized loan products to accommodate LLC borrowers. The liability shield works both ways – if you face personal financial difficulties, creditors typically cannot seize LLC-owned properties to satisfy personal debts.
Tax Advantages and Flexibility
LLCs offer exceptional tax flexibility for real estate investors. By default, single-member LLCs are "disregarded entities" for tax purposes, meaning income and expenses flow through to your personal tax return. However, you can elect corporate taxation if it becomes more beneficial as your portfolio grows. When you get a loan with an LLC in Jersey City, you can deduct mortgage interest, property taxes, and other business expenses directly against rental income.
Multi-member LLCs provide additional benefits, allowing you to distribute profits and losses among members according to your operating agreement, potentially optimizing everyone's tax situation. This flexibility becomes particularly valuable when structuring Jersey City investment property loan LLC arrangements with partners or family members.

Initial Pre-Qualification and Documentation
The loan process begins with pre-qualification, where lenders evaluate your LLC's financial standing and investment strategy. When applying for a Jersey City investment property loan LLC, you'll need to provide comprehensive documentation including your LLC's operating agreement, tax returns, bank statements, and proof of business registration in New Jersey. Most lenders require your LLC to have been operating for at least two years, though some specialized lenders offer programs for newer entities.
Your personal credit score remains important, as most lenders require personal guarantees from LLC members with 20% or greater ownership stakes. A minimum credit score of 620-680 is typically required, though premium lenders may demand scores above 720 for the best rates and terms.
Property Evaluation and DSCR Analysis
For investors wondering how to buy property with an LLC in Jersey City, understanding the Debt Service Coverage Ratio (DSCR) is crucial. A DSCR loan for LLC New Jersey focuses primarily on the property's income-generating potential rather than personal income verification. Lenders typically require a minimum DSCR of 1.20-1.25, meaning the property's net operating income must exceed the debt service by 20-25%.
The property appraisal process for LLC loans often takes 2-3 weeks, during which lenders assess both current market value and rental income potential. Jersey City's diverse neighborhoods—from the waterfront luxury districts to emerging areas like Journal Square—each present unique valuation considerations that experienced lenders understand intimately.
Loan Structure and Terms
LLC real estate loans in Jersey City typically feature different structures than conventional mortgages. Interest rates generally run 0.5-2% higher than owner-occupied residential loans, with most lenders offering 20-30 year amortization schedules. Down payment requirements usually range from 20-25% for investment properties, though some portfolio lenders may accept as little as 15% for well-qualified borrowers.
Many investors opt for interest-only payment periods during the initial 1-5 years, providing enhanced cash flow for property improvements or additional acquisitions. This flexibility makes Jersey City particularly attractive for investors implementing value-add strategies in the city's rapidly appreciating market.
Alternative Financing: Hard Money Solutions
When traditional financing timelines don't align with investment opportunities, a Jersey City hard money loan for LLC provides rapid funding solutions. These asset-based loans can close in 7-14 days, making them ideal for competitive bidding situations or properties requiring immediate renovation work.
Hard money lenders focus primarily on the property's after-repair value (ARV) and your experience level, with less emphasis on extensive financial documentation. Rates typically range from 8-15% with 6-24 month terms, providing the speed necessary to secure prime Jersey City properties in today's fast-moving market.

Understanding the Personal Guarantee (PG) in New Jersey
When seeking to get a loan with an LLC Jersey City investors often encounter the concept of a personal guarantee (PG), which can significantly impact your financing strategy. Understanding this crucial component is essential for making informed decisions about your Jersey City investment property loan LLC applications.
What is a Personal Guarantee in LLC Real Estate Financing?
A personal guarantee is a legal commitment where you, as the LLC member or guarantor, personally agree to repay the debt if your LLC defaults on the loan. For those looking to secure an NJ LLC real estate loan, this means that despite the limited liability protection your LLC typically provides, you're putting your personal assets at risk to secure financing for your investment property.
In New Jersey's competitive real estate market, lenders often require personal guarantees because LLCs are separate legal entities with potentially limited assets. This requirement becomes particularly relevant when pursuing a DSCR loan for LLC New Jersey transactions, where lenders evaluate both the property's cash flow and the borrower's personal financial strength.
Types of Personal Guarantees for Jersey City LLC Loans
Understanding the different types of personal guarantees can help you negotiate better terms when learning how to buy property with an LLC in Jersey City:
Full Recourse Personal Guarantee: This provides the lender with complete access to your personal assets if the LLC defaults. Most traditional lenders require this type when financing investment properties through LLCs.
Limited Personal Guarantee: This caps your personal liability to a specific dollar amount or percentage of the loan. Some specialized lenders offering Jersey City hard money loans for LLC may accept limited guarantees for experienced investors.
Non-Recourse Loans: These rare financing options don't require personal guarantees, though they typically come with higher interest rates and stricter qualification requirements.
New Jersey-Specific Considerations
New Jersey's legal framework provides certain protections for personal guarantors that investors should understand. The state follows specific foreclosure procedures that can affect how personal guarantees are enforced. Additionally, New Jersey's homestead exemption laws may protect your primary residence from creditors seeking to collect on a personal guarantee, though this protection has limitations.
When working with LLC mortgage lenders NJ, it's crucial to understand that personal guarantee requirements can vary significantly based on factors such as your credit score, the loan-to-value ratio, and the property's debt service coverage ratio.
Strategies to Minimize Personal Guarantee Exposure
Experienced Jersey City investors employ several strategies to reduce their personal guarantee exposure:
Strong Financial Position: Demonstrating substantial personal assets, excellent credit, and significant real estate experience can help negotiate more favorable guarantee terms.
Higher Down Payments: Increasing your equity stake in the property reduces lender risk and may result in limited guarantee requirements.
Multiple LLC Strategy: Using separate LLCs for different properties can limit cross-collateralization and reduce overall exposure.

Required Documents for Your New Jersey LLC Loan
Securing a nj llc real estate loan requires thorough documentation that demonstrates your LLC's financial stability and your ability to repay the loan. When you're looking to get a loan with an llc jersey city, lenders need comprehensive paperwork to evaluate your investment opportunity and assess risk properly.
Essential LLC Formation Documents
Before pursuing a jersey city investment property loan llc, ensure your LLC documentation is complete and up-to-date. You'll need your New Jersey Certificate of Formation, which proves your LLC's legal existence in the state. Additionally, your Operating Agreement is crucial as it outlines ownership structure, management responsibilities, and profit distribution among members.
Your LLC's Federal Employer Identification Number (EIN) documentation is mandatory for all loan applications. This tax identification number allows lenders to verify your business entity and conduct proper underwriting for your dscr loan for llc new jersey.
Financial Documentation Requirements
When learning how to buy property with an llc in jersey city, understanding financial documentation requirements is paramount. Lenders typically require two years of business tax returns (Form 1065) for your LLC, along with personal tax returns from all LLC members who guarantee the loan.
Bank statements for both your LLC business accounts and personal accounts of guarantors are essential. Most lenders request 3-6 months of recent statements to verify cash flow and reserves. For a jersey city hard money loan for llc, some lenders may accept shorter financial histories but may require larger down payments.
Property-Specific Documentation
Your investment property documentation package should include a purchase agreement or letter of intent, property appraisal, and comprehensive property inspection reports. For rental properties, provide current lease agreements, rent rolls, and operating expense statements to demonstrate the property's income-generating potential.
When seeking llc mortgage lenders nj, include property insurance quotes and environmental assessments if required. These documents help lenders evaluate the collateral securing your loan and determine appropriate loan-to-value ratios.
Personal Guarantor Information
Most LLC loans require personal guarantees from members with significant ownership stakes. Personal guarantors must provide credit reports, personal financial statements detailing assets and liabilities, and employment verification letters or business ownership documentation.
Debt-to-income calculations are critical for loan approval, so compile all existing debt obligations including mortgages, credit cards, and other business loans. This information helps lenders assess your overall financial capacity beyond the LLC's performance.
Additional Documentation for Specialized Loans
For DSCR (Debt Service Coverage Ratio) loans, emphasis shifts from personal income to property cash flow. Prepare detailed rent rolls, lease agreements, and property management statements demonstrating the property's ability to service debt payments independently.
Hard money lenders may require additional documentation including contractor estimates for renovation projects, detailed project timelines, and exit strategy plans. These lenders focus heavily on the after-repair value (ARV) and your experience in similar investments.
